Checklist
- Keep certificates current and filed against the exact model name.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.

Frequently asked questions
Which certificates does Prime 3 need?
It depends on destination; electrical safety, battery transport and chemical compliance documents are the usual set.
What happens if a batch fails inspection?
The agreed procedure normally covers replacement of affected units or credit against the next order, documented before shipment.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
